Today my planned activity was slime! When I showed the kids at the centre that we were doing this activity they were so excited. I bough glitter glue and was excited to show them how to do it. It was more of an experiment than something I knew could be successful. I was really kind of worried that it wouldn’t turn out. THEN, I realized that they actually don’t care. They were having so much fun just stirring glue that it didn’t really matter that it wasn’t working.


I keep learning new limits and boundaries with the kids and today I learned that they just need to be moving and that is an activity. They have very low expectations of me and I hope to raise the bar for the next interns, but the goal is to keep them moving and keep them introduced into something new. 


I realized this week how fulfilling it is to introduce something to someone. I introduced Carmella to Papa’s Cupcakeria and I introduced Primavera to slime.
